lib/PublicInbox/View.pm | 4 +++- diff --git a/lib/PublicInbox/View.pm b/lib/PublicInbox/View.pm index 15d846a635425dc66c7b2ffe37cd11a1e24e7453..a3a955b2b520515340e57f4bee289cad4ab147f6 100644 --- a/lib/PublicInbox/View.pm +++ b/lib/PublicInbox/View.pm @@ -817,7 +817,9 @@ $subj = $state->{srch}->subject_normalized($subj); $topic = $subj; # kill "[PATCH v2]" etc. for summarization - $topic =~ s/\A\s*\[[^\]]+\]\s*//g; + unless ($level == 0) { + $topic =~ s/\A\s*\[[^\]]+\]\s*//g; + } $topic = substr($topic, 0, 30); if (++$state->{subjs}->{$topic} == 1) {